Select the term that describes the constant portion in this quadratic equation.
Goryan [66]

Answer: 16

Step-by-step explanation:

A quadratic function is a function of the form f(x) = ax2 +bx+c, where a, b, and c are constants and a = 0. The term ax2 is called the quadratic term (hence the name given to the function), the term bx is called the linear term, and the term c is called the constant term.

Therefore, the constant term in the equation is 16.
